Hattiesburg, Mississippi Speed Traps
from airport to end of city limits
From the airport into town the police are hiding in the bushes and radaring people. Almost no one seepds through there because they know. The out of towners are speeding and getting busted everytime. You cannot see them at all until they are behind you. From the west as you enter the town there is a hill. At the top of the hill the poice radar and before you know it your busted. I-59 (anywhere within city limits)
Hattiesburg Drug Enforcement Units use speed traps as an excuse to pull you over and search your car. Many K-9 units patrol the highway, and the dogs will "indicate" even if you have nothing in your car. If you are from out of state, and aren’t wearing a suit, expect to be pulled over.

W. 4th St. (Between HWY 49/ 38th Ave)
Campus police set up on either side of the road. They are in parking lots or in plain view as though they are parked along the "shoulder."
